Softball Recap: Hector Wildcats vs. Atkins Red Devils
After some red-hot attacks at the plate in their last six games, Hector finally came back down to earth on Thursday. They came up short against the Atkins Red Devils, falling 6-0. The contest marked the first time this season in which the Wildcats were not able to get on the board.

Hector saw five different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Sarena Myers, who went a perfect 3-for-3 with one stolen base. Myers is crushing it when it comes to stolen bases: she's snagged at least one every time she's taken the field this season.
Having lost for the first time this season, Hector fell to 6-1. As for Atkins, the victory made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 7-2.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Hector will challenge Danville at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. Atkins will get to enjoy the win for a while: their next game is against Perryville at 4:30 p.m. on April 1st. Perryville is on a six-game streak of home wins, Atkins a five-game streak of away wins (dating back to last season)-- so someone will have to leave a streak behind on the field.
